Introduction: Every year, 25 people die while working in confined spaces in the UK. The majority of victims work in the construction industry. Many of these deaths are preventable. Understanding the unique risks of carrying out work in these environments and insisting on safer working practices is essential to upholding worker health and safety. This course provides a comprehensive overview of the risks associated with working in confined spaces, the obligations of employers and employees under the law and the practical measures that will reduce the risk of injury and death. What You Will Learn: The criteria that governs what constitutes a âconfined spaceâ and why it is important to understand this definition. The hazards that make working in a confined space dangerous, including excessive heat, fumes and low levels of oxygen. Why it is essential to undertake a risk assessment prior to commencing work in confined spaces and the steps you should take when evaluating potential hazards. Best practices for working in confined spaces, including how to ensure adequate lighting, ventilation and systems of communication. Driving Innovation from Within - A Guide for Employees and Organizational Leaders 'Innovation' brings to mind the maverick entrepreneur who quits their job, at unimaginable odds, to build a business on their own. But this entrepreneurial story is a myth. As a successful entrepreneur, author, consultant and CEO, Kaihan Krippendorff argues that intrapreneurs - employees who incubate new businesses within corporations - have had a far greater impact on the world. Nearly all of the most transformative innovations over the past three decades, from e-mail and the Internet to DNA sequencing and MRI scans, were introduced by employees who did not quit their jobs but instead took the challenge of innovating from within. Drawing on five years of in-depth research of hundreds of successful innovators and Intrapreneurial Intensity, as well as insights from thought leaders, C-suite leaders, business unit leaders, and front-line employees, Kaihan will share exclusive insights from his book, Driving Innovation From Within: A Guide for Internal Entrepreneurs (Columbia University Press, 2019).
